The Allen-Bradley BASIC Modules (Catalog No. 1771-DB and Catalog No.
1746-BAS) provide a cost-effective and efficient serial interface to
Allen-Bradley PLC and SLC controllers. The BASIC Modules store all
messages in battery-backed RAM or EPROM. The modules can be
programmed to transmit these messages along with status or variable data
from the programmable controller.

The BASIC Modules support both RS-232 and RS-422 applications. For
more information on the BASIC Modules, refer to the user’s manuals.
